NORTH DAKOTA SURVEY of 500 likely voters
Wednesday January 25, 2006

1* In the election for the U.S. Senate, suppose the Republicans nominate Wayne Stenehjem and the Democrats nominate Kent Conrad? If the election were held today, would you vote for Republican Wayne Stenehjem or for Democrat Kent Conrad?
40% Stenehjem
53% Conrad
3% some other candidate
4% not sure
2* Okay… what if the Republicans nominate Kevin Cramer? If the election were held today, would you vote for Republican Kevin Cramer or for Democrat Kent Conrad?
35% Cramer
57% Conrad
2% some other candidate
5% not sure
3* Last one…what if the Republicans nominate John Warford. If the election were held today, would you vote for Republican John Warford or for Democrat Kent Conrad?
31% Warford
59% Conrad
3% some other candidate
6% not sure

5* Some people say that there is a natural tension between protecting individual rights and national security. In the United States today, does our legal system worry too much about protecting individual rights, too much about protecting national security, or is the balance about right?
35% worry too much about protecting individual right
23%worry too much about protecting national security
30% the balance is about right
12% not sure
6* Okay…how would you rate President Bush’s handling of the US economy…Excellent, good, fair, or poor?
20% excellent
22% good
20% fair
36% poor
1% not sure
7* Overall, how would you rate President Bush’s handling of the situation in Iraq…Excellent, good, fair, or poor?
22% excellent
22% good
15% fair
41% poor
1% not sure
8* When it comes to determining how you will vote in the U.S. Senate race this year, which issue is more important… immigration, or the situation in Iraq?
23% immigration
66% situation in Iraq
11% not sure
9* A proposal has been made to build a barrier along the U.S. - Mexican border. Do you favor or oppose building a barrier to help reduce illegal immigration?
62% favor
28% oppose
10% not sure
NOTE: Margin of Sampling Error, +/- 4.5 percentage points with a 95% level of confidence.
